Leesville, Louisiana Population:

Leesville, Louisiana has a population of 6,753 as of 2000.

Population Breakdown in Leesville, Louisiana:

Caucasian - 3,620
African American - 2,362
Hispanic - 332
Other - 439

Leesville, LA. Education Information:

Leesville had a total of 1,431 high school graduates in 2000.
Leesville, LA. has a total of 570 college graduates with a bachelor's degree
or higher and 1,114 people with some college education. (Includes
Associates Degree)

Leesville Family Info Breakdown:

Leesville has a total of 388 single parents with children.
There are also 436 parents who are married with children in Leesville, Louisiana.

Leesville, Louisiana Housing Breakdown:

Leesville has 1,392 houses that are owner occupied.
Leesville has 1,449 houses that are renter-occupied.
Around 532 houses are vacant in Leesville, Louisiana.
$59,800 is the average value of a house in Leesville, LA.
$357 is the average cost to rent a house in Leesville.

Leesville, Louisiana Income Information:

The average income per family is $30,250 in Leesville.

What should I expect during alcohol rehab in Leesville?


Attending an Alcohol Rehabilitation Program and Alcohol Detoxification Facility in Leesville can be different for each person, however, there are some similarities that can be expected. The first step of a Leesville Alcohol Treatment Program and Alcohol Detoxification Center is often alcohol detoxification (withdrawal). Alcohol withdrawal is when a person with an alcohol abuse problem stops drinking alcohol. Alcohol withdrawal can last a few days and may include nausea or vomiting, sweating, shakiness, and anxiety. These symptoms will be reduced effectively by attending an Alcohol Rehabilitation Facility and Alcohol Detox Center in Leesville. Some Alcoholism Treatment and Alcohol Detoxification Centers in Leesville will offer an on-site alcohol detox while others may have you attend an off-site medical detox center and then have you return to complete the Leesville Alcohol Rehab Center and Alcohol Detox Center once the detoxification process is complete. Either way, the person in recovery must withdrawal from the alcohol which is safer and more comfortable when done as part of a Leesville Alcohol Treatment Center.

For some, the initial alcohol detox process is the hardest part of attending an Alcohol Rehabilitation Program and Alcohol Detox Facility in Leesville. Others find that their difficulty arises in therapy where they must confront their misguided beliefs and addictive behaviors. Often times, the recovering alcohol abuser will tend to unknowingly focus on present time problems going on with family, friends, loved ones, and issues at home. This is usually an attempt to avoid confronting their own problems by focusing on outside distractions. It is important for family and loved ones to avoid involving the addict with issues at home or anything other than their treatment plan. The addict must keep focused on himself and confront his own issues and his case points that need addressed.

What is the Primary Focus of an Alcohol Rehab in Leesville?


The primary focus of an Alcohol Rehabilitation Program and Alcohol Detoxification Facility in Leesville is not only to help the individual to stop drinking alcohol, but also to restore the person to productive functioning within their family, relationships, workplace and community. While attending an effective Alcohol Treatment Program and Alcohol Detoxification Center in Leesville the individual will learn life skills, coping skills, and work through underlying issues, trauma's and transgressions. They will be better able to cope with daily life and manage their thoughts, feelings and emotions.

The first focus of most Alcoholism Treatment and Alcohol Detoxification Centers in Leesville is often alcohol detox where the individual is restored physically back to health. Various methods may be used to monitor, manage, and minimize alcohol withdrawal symptoms. Focus is then put on diet, nutrition, exercise and sleep until the individual is eating healthy meals regularly, sleeping regularly, has increased energy and feels healthy physically.

The next focus of an effective Alcohol Rehabilitation Facility and Alcohol Detox Center in Leesville involves working to improve self-esteem and self-worth, heal core traumas, learn life-skills, gain control over addictive patterns and improve psychological health in addition to recovering from alcohol abuse. Counseling focuses on the symptoms of alcohol abuse, the individual and the structure of the individual's recovery program. It teaches coping strategies and tools for recovery.

The final focus of an effective Alcohol Rehab Center and Alcohol Detox Center in Leesville is to also to offer the individual the necessary tools to continue to remain alcohol-free once they have completed the rehab program and have re-entered into society. Clients will learn about addiction, recovery, relapse, and how to address misguided beliefs about self, others, and their environment. In addition, they learn to identify relapse warning signs and methods to challenge thoughts that may lead to relapse.




How Much Do Alcohol Treatment Programs Cost in Leesville?


The cost of an Alcohol Rehabilitation Program and Alcohol Detoxification Facility in Leesville can vary tremendously depending on many factors, such as the type of Alcohol Treatment Program and Alcohol Detoxification Center, the length of stay, the quality and credentials of the staff, and what services are included. All these factors make the question, "How much does alcohol rehab cost?" extremely difficult to answer with simplicity. If you are seeking the best value for your treatment dollar, remember: price can be meaningful only in the context of quality and performance.

The cost of rehabilitation for alcohol abuse can be expensive. Full-time, inpatient, or residential Alcoholism Treatment and Alcohol Detoxification Centers in Leesville can cost from $400 to $1200 per day in some cases. The average cost for a residential Alcohol Rehabilitation Facility and Alcohol Detox Center is about $7,000 per month. Additionally, there are Alcohol Rehabilitation and Alcohol Detoxification Facilities in Leesville that are free (paid for by our taxes) however the quality of treatment is very low and success rates can suffer tremendously. Outpatient care is typically less expensive. Insurance may cover some or all of the cost of an Alcohol Rehab Center and Alcohol Detox Center in Leesville so it is important to check with you insurance provider to find out what they may cover in your case.

Most yeasts cannot grow when the concentration of alcohol is higher than about 18% by volume, so that is a practical limit for the strength of fermented beverages such as wine, beer, and sake.

0.13-0.15 Blood Alcohol Concentration (BAC): Gross motor impairment and lack of physical control. Blurred vision and major loss of balance. Euphoria is reduced and dysphoria (anxiety, restlessness) is beginning to appear. Judgment and perception are severely impaired.
